When the executives at Control Data Corporation found out that "Universal" was planning a major movie featuring a computer, they saw their chance for some public exposure, and they agreed to supply, free of charge, $4.8 million worth of computer equipment and the technicians to oversee its use."I love old science fiction because it's all like 'IT'S THE DISTANT YEAR TWO THOUSAND AND THREE AND MAN IS EXPLORING THE DEEP CORNERS OF THE UNIVERSE' like g...Brief Synopsis. Colossus: The Forbin Project Tucked away in a secret location in the Rockies, Dr. Charles Forbin has developed a massive … az fox 10 weather Colossus is the main antagonist of the 1970 science fiction film Colossus: The Forbin Project. It is a self-aware military supercomputer that defies its creators to implement its own global agenda. It was voiced by Paul Frees, who also voiced Boris Badenov and Burgermeister Meisterburger. Ed Solomon, screenwriter for Men in Black and Bill & Ted's Excellent Adventure/Bogus Journey, has been brought onboard to rewrite the … hampton inn janesville Colossus: The Forbin Project is a quiet but highly effective little film. It was poorly distributed in its time and never found the audience it should have. The film was made right after 2001: A Space Odyssey (1968) and, although based on a 1966 novel by D.F.
